Truth’s a Dog Must to Kennel opened at the Lyceum Theatre Studio, Edinburgh, during Fringe 2022 and comes to SoHo Playhouse as part of the Fringe Encore Series. It uses King Lear as a point of departure to explore the aftermath of the last three years: the loss of life, the wrecking of families, the abuse of power, the digital encroachment of live theatre and the decimation of our industry.

The Fool leaves Shakespeare's King Lear before the blinding. Before the killing starts. Before the ice-creams in the interval. In this new solo work, Obie Award winner Tim Crouch draws on ideas of virtual reality to send him back to the future of the play he left. Back to a world laid waste by division and trauma; a world where the revolution will take place on a screen. Truth’s a Dog Must to Kennel is a celebration of live performance and a skewering of the state we’re in now: King Lear meets stand-up meets the metaverse.
